   European Stars And Stripes (Newspaper) - April 23, 1986, Darmstadt, Hesse                                Page 28 the stars and stripes wednesday april 23, 1986 10 americans flee Beirut s moslem area Beirut Lebanon a ten americans who stayed in West Beirut despite the threat of kidnapping by islamic extremists fled the City s moslem sector tuesday under heavy guard. But Many other americans chose not to leave. The americans who were evacuated joined dozens of britons and other westerners who left West Beirut during the weekend for fear of being abducted by terrorists seek ing to avenge the . Air strike on Libya last week. Police said Christian and moslem militia snipers held their fire As two buses carrying the americans and six pc uploads of police rolled past the dividing Green line and into Christian East Beirut. The policemen escorted the americans through East Beirut to the . Embassy in the Christian suburb of Aukar 12 Miles North. Druse militiamen escorted the Convoy on the 15-minute drive through West Beirut. They kept the doors of their cars open during the trip and kept their fingers ready on the triggers of the Kalashnikov rifles they thrust through the doors. Drivers blared their horns. A . Embassy official said the evacuees would stay with friends in East Beirut and there were no plans to Fly them out of the country. But shortly after he spoke a . Navy helicopter was seen Landing in the embassy courtyard and taking off 10 minutes later. It could not be determined whether any evacuees were aboard. The embassy official said Many americans remained in West Beirut a lot of those who were born in Lebanon and with dual  he added there Are also those who refused to leave for various reasons. I cannot give you an exact number. We did our Job. We advised them to leave but we cannot Force them to  the evacuation began at Dawn tuesday when the americans some of them in tears began assembling at the former . Consulate in West Beirut s bin Are Issei Seaside Boulevard. Sharpshooters from Walid Jumblatt s druse militia manned rooftops overlooking approaches to the area and druse militia checkpoints were set up All around the for Mer consulate and the american University of Beirut Campus. Reporters saw six men and four women arrive separately at the Assembly spot each carrying a medium size suitcase. At least three evacuees were professors at the american University. Others worked at the College protestant fran cais the american International College and the Rashi Deen International language Center a privately owned Institute. The rest refused to talk to reporters. The exodus of westerners was touched off by the slay Ings of kidnapped american librarian Peter Kilburn and two British teachers and the abduction of British television cameraman John Mccarthy. Kilburn 62, of san Francisco and 34-year-old Leigh Douglas and 40-year-old Peter Padfield were found shot to death along a tree lined Mountain Highway East of Beirut. Next to their bodies was a note saying they had been killed in retaliation for the raid on Libya. The . Total of multiple warhead mis Siles now stands at 1,198, just two below the limit set in the treaty signed by then presi Dent Carter and the late soviet Leader Leo nid Brezhnev in Vienna. It was the last major arms control agreement by the two superpowers setting limits on various categories of Long Range nuclear weapons. Reagan denounced the pact in his Campaign for the presidency in 1980 As fatally  in office however he promised that the United states would not undercut its pro visions provided the soviets also observed the treaty. The White House press office issued a written statement that said the president has begun consultations with the allies and Congress on his tentative  the statement by spokesman Larry Speakes said that the substance of those consultations Are confidential and that no final decision had been taken or would be taken until they were completed. We will not comment on the substance of the consultations at this time Speakes said. He said the United states would consider its Security needs and a threat posed by the soviet Union in making a judgment. Edward l. Rowny a senior adviser left sunday for Tokyo to meet with japanese leaders. He will go on to South Korea China and Canada. Paul h. Nitze meanwhile was flying tuesday to London. After seeing British officials he planned to make stops in West Germany Italy France Belgium and the Netherlands. Nitze also will Brief the nato Council while in Brussels. The Trident is due to begin sea trials May 20. Its 24 missiles would put the United states above the ceiling of 1,200 missiles with multiple warheads set by the 1979 treaty unless older missiles were destroyed. Most of the president s advisers including defense Secretary Caspar Weinberger urged him to permit the . Total to sur pass the ceiling As a response to alleged soviet violations. Rowny Cia director William Casey and . Arms control director Kenneth Adelman All lined up with Weinberger. Only two senior advisers Secretary of state George Shultz and Nitze recommended that the United states maintain its policy of not undercutting the treaty. King Cruger . Bureau Banbury England five anti nuclear weapons protesters have been charged with criminal damage for painting two f 111 aircraft at nearby Raf upper Heyford late monday night. The women four britons and a French citizen who All gave the women s peace Camp at Raf Greenham common eng land As their address were refused bail at a magistrates court hearing tuesday and were sent to London s Holloway prison where they will be confined until a hearing april 30. The women plus a sixth woman who was not charged tuesday in connection with the incident were apprehended on the base at about 11 30 . Monday by air Force Security police after allegedly painting two full aircraft with symbols and slogans said a ministry of defense spokesman in London. He said the women were handed Over to ministry of defense police who arrested them. Cuts had been made monday night in the Security Fence at Raf upper Heyford said it. Col. Doug Kennett 3rd air Force spokesman at Raf Mildenhall England. He said the defaced planes were Falls and were not any of the ef-111 Raven aircraft from the base that were used in last week s raids against Libya.
